Fluid Checks and Changes: The Lifeblood of Your Civic
Fluids are essential for lubrication, cooling, and performance. Checking them regularly and changing them on schedule prevents costly damage. Always refer to your owner’s manual for specific intervals and fluid types.
*
Engine Oil:
* Check monthly using the dipstick. Ensure the car is on level ground and the engine is cool. * Use synthetic oil as recommended by Honda (e.g., 0W-20). * Change every 5,000-7,500 miles or as indicated by your car’s maintenance minder system. This is a crucial step for engine health. *
Transmission Fluid (CVT):
* Honda CVTs require specific fluid (Honda HCF-2). Do not substitute. * Inspect fluid level and condition every 30,000 miles. * Consider changing every 60,000-90,000 miles, especially if you drive in heavy traffic or extreme conditions. This can be a DIY job but requires precision. *
Brake Fluid:
* Check the reservoir level monthly. Low fluid can indicate worn pads or a leak. * Flush and replace every 2-3 years, or as recommended. Fresh fluid prevents corrosion and maintains braking performance. *
Coolant:
* Check the reservoir level weekly when the engine is cold. * Ensure it’s Honda Type 2 coolant. * Replace every 5 years or 60,000 miles to prevent engine overheating. *
Power Steering Fluid:
* The 2024 Civic uses electric power steering, so there’s no hydraulic fluid to check or change. This simplifies maintenance!
Tire Care: Your Contact with the Road
Tires are your only point of contact with the road, making their condition vital for safety and handling. Proper tire maintenance also improves fuel efficiency.
*
Tire Pressure:
* Check weekly with a reliable gauge. Look for the recommended pressure on the driver’s side door jamb placard. * Under-inflated tires wear unevenly and reduce fuel economy. Over-inflated tires reduce traction and ride comfort. *
Tire Rotation:
* Rotate tires every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even wear across all four tires. This extends tire life significantly. * A simple cross-pattern rotation works well for front-wheel-drive vehicles like the Civic. *
Tread Depth:
* Use a tread depth gauge or the “penny test” monthly. Insert a penny upside down into a tread groove. If you can see the top of Lincoln’s head, your tires are getting low and need replacement soon. * Replace tires when tread depth reaches 4/32″ for optimal wet weather performance.
Brake System Inspections: Stopping Power is Safety Power
Your brakes are critical for safety. Regular inspection ensures they are always ready when you need them.
*
Pad and Rotor Wear:
* Inspect visually every oil change. Look through the wheel spokes for pad thickness and rotor condition. * Pads should have at least 3-4mm of material remaining. * Rotors should be smooth, without deep grooves or excessive rust. *
Brake Fluid:
(As mentioned above) Ensure it’s clean and at the correct level. *
Brake Lines and Hoses:
* Check for any leaks, cracks, or bulges in the brake lines and rubber hoses. This is a critical safety check. * If you notice a soft brake pedal or increased stopping distance, have your brakes inspected immediately by a professional.

Intake and Exhaust Systems: Breathing Easier, Sounding Better
Upgrading your intake and exhaust can improve engine breathing and give your Civic a sportier sound. These are popular first modifications for many enthusiasts.
*
Cold Air Intake (CAI):
* A CAI replaces the restrictive factory airbox with a less restrictive filter and tube. This allows the engine to draw in cooler, denser air. * Benefits include a slight increase in horsepower and a more aggressive engine sound, especially under acceleration. *
Installation Tip:
Ensure all sensors are reconnected correctly to avoid check engine lights. *
Cat-Back Exhaust System:
* A cat-back system replaces the exhaust piping from the catalytic converter back to the tailpipe. * It can reduce back pressure, improving exhaust flow, and give your Civic a throatier, more refined exhaust note. * Choose a system known for quality and fitment. Look for stainless steel options for longevity.
Suspension Upgrades: Sharpening the Handling
For those who crave a more dynamic driving experience, suspension modifications can significantly improve handling and cornering.
*
Lowering Springs:
* These replace your factory springs with shorter, stiffer ones, lowering the car’s center of gravity. * Benefits include reduced body roll, improved aesthetics, and sharper turn-in. *
Caution:
Lowering too much can compromise ride comfort and potentially damage suspension components on rough roads. It might also impact tire wear if not aligned properly. *
Performance Shocks/Struts:
* Pairing lowering springs with performance-matched shocks and struts is crucial. Stock shocks are not designed for lower springs and can wear out quickly. * Performance dampers offer better control and rebound, complementing the stiffer springs. *
Sway Bars:
* Upgraded front and/or rear sway bars reduce body roll during cornering. * This is an excellent way to dial in handling without significantly impacting ride quality.

Dashboard Warning Lights: Decoding the Signals
Modern cars communicate problems through dashboard warning lights. Understanding what they mean is the first step in diagnosis.
*
Check Engine Light (CEL):
* This can be triggered by a wide range of issues, from a loose gas cap to a failing sensor. *
DIY Step:
First, check your gas cap. If it’s loose, tighten it and drive for a bit; the light may reset. *
Next Step:
Use an OBD-II scanner (available at auto parts stores) to read the diagnostic trouble code (DTC). This code will point you towards the specific system with the fault. *
When to Call a Pro:
If the light is flashing, or if you notice a significant drop in performance, seek immediate professional help. *
Low Tire Pressure Warning:
* Indicates one or more tires are significantly underinflated. *
DIY Step:
Check all tire pressures with a gauge and inflate to the recommended PSI. If it keeps coming on, you might have a slow leak. *
Maintenance Minder System:
* This isn’t a “problem” light but a reminder for scheduled service (e.g., oil change, tire rotation). *
DIY Step:
Perform the recommended service and then reset the minder system as per your owner’s manual.
Brake Noises: Squeaks, Grinds, and Growls
Unusual brake noises are often a sign that something needs attention. Ignoring them can lead to more serious problems.
*
Squealing Brakes:
* Often caused by worn brake pads (the wear indicator rubbing against the rotor) or glazing on the pads/rotors. *
DIY Step:
Inspect brake pads for wear. If pads are low, replace them. If pads look good, try cleaning the rotors with brake cleaner. *
Grinding Noise:
* This is a serious sign, indicating metal-on-metal contact, meaning your brake pads are completely worn out. *
Action:
Stop driving immediately and have your brakes inspected and replaced by a professional. This can cause significant rotor damage. *
Pulsating Brake Pedal:
* Usually a sign of warped brake rotors. *
Action:
Rotors may need to be resurfaced or replaced. This is typically a job for a mechanic with proper equipment.

What kind of oil does a 2024 Honda Civic Sport Sedan 4D take?
The 2024 Honda Civic Sport Sedan 4D typically requires 0W-20 full synthetic engine oil. Always check your owner’s manual for the exact specification and capacity, as well as the recommended oil change intervals.
How often should I change the transmission fluid in my 2024 Honda Civic Sport Sedan 4D?
For the CVT transmission, Honda generally recommends inspecting the fluid every 30,000 miles and changing it every 60,000 to 90,000 miles, or as indicated by the maintenance minder system. If you drive in severe conditions (heavy traffic, mountainous terrain), more frequent changes may be beneficial. Only use Honda HCF-2 fluid.
